Residents Demand Action on Abandoned Chinese Club Building in San Nicolas

Source: 24ora·1 hour ago·Aruba·1 min read

Community members in Aruba are calling on authorities to take action on the deteriorating former Chinese Club building in San Nicolas, a situation that has drawn public concern for over a year. The local news outlet 24ora.com first reported on the troubling condition of the structure approximately one year ago, but residents say nothing has been done since. The building, a once-prominent landmark in the San Nicolas neighborhood, has continued to fall into disrepair without any visible intervention from officials or property owners. Locals are frustrated by the lack of response and are now publicly appealing for something to be done about the eyesore, which they feel negatively impacts the community. The continued neglect of the building raises concerns about safety, neighborhood aesthetics, and the broader revitalization efforts in San Nicolas, an area that has seen ongoing urban renewal initiatives in recent years.
